Auburn Expands Professional Education Opportunities in Birmingham
Auburn University is bringing more of its expertise directly to Greater Birmingham through new professional and executive education courses offered by the Harbert College of Business at Auburn in Birmingham.
The new open-enrollment programs are designed to connect Auburn faculty with Birmingham’s strong business community through focused, practical courses for working professionals. Participants can build new skills and explore emerging business challenges without committing to another degree or traveling to Auburn.
The courses are intentionally designed around real-world application. Professionals can step away from their day-to-day responsibilities, focus on a particular skill or business challenge, and return to work with new ideas, tools and perspectives they can immediately put into practice.
First Course Focuses on Practical AI
The first course, Practical AI for Business, will be offered October 15, 2026, at Auburn in Birmingham.
As artificial intelligence continues to reshape industries and workplaces, the course is designed to help business leaders and professionals better understand how AI can be used thoughtfully and effectively.
Participants will explore how to identify areas where AI can create value, recognize situations where caution may be warranted and make more informed decisions about incorporating AI into their work.
The course reflects a growing reality for organizations of all sizes: AI literacy is quickly becoming an important part of overall business literacy.
More Courses Coming to Birmingham
Practical AI for Business is only the beginning.
Future Harbert College professional education offerings in Birmingham are expected to address topics including leadership, financial decision-making, organizational change, customer insights and business growth, and responsive supply chains.
The programs will generally be offered in one- and two-day formats, providing Birmingham-area professionals with opportunities to continue learning while giving local employers another resource for developing their teams.
